index
:
delta/qt5/qtserialport.git
5.10
5.10.0
5.10.1
5.11
5.11.0
5.11.1
5.11.2
5.11.3
5.12
5.12.0
5.12.1
5.12.10
5.12.11
5.12.12
5.12.2
5.12.3
5.12.4
5.12.5
5.12.6
5.12.7
5.12.8
5.12.9
5.13
5.13.0
5.13.1
5.13.2
5.14
5.14.0
5.14.1
5.14.2
5.15
5.15.0
5.15.1
5.15.2
5.3
5.3.0
5.3.1
5.3.2
5.4
5.4.0
5.4.1
5.4.2
5.5
5.5.0
5.5.1
5.6
5.6.0
5.6.1
5.6.2
5.6.3
5.7
5.7.0
5.7.1
5.8
5.8.0
5.9
5.9.0
5.9.1
5.9.2
5.9.3
5.9.4
5.9.5
5.9.6
5.9.7
5.9.8
6.2
6.2.0
6.2.1
6.2.2
6.2.3
6.2.4
6.3
6.4
6.4.0
6.4.1
6.4.2
6.4.3
6.5
6.5.0
6.5.1
baserock/morph
baserock/v5.3.0
dev
old/5.1
old/5.2
qt4-dev
release
stable
wip/cmake
wip/qt6
code.qt.io: qt/qtserialport.git
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
serialport
/
qserialport_win.cpp
Commit message (
Expand
)
Author
Age
Files
Lines
*
Port QWinOverlappedIoNotifier to QDeadlineTimer
Thiago Macieira
2017-08-15
1
-11
/
+7
*
Merge remote-tracking branch 'origin/5.9' into dev
Liang Qi
2017-06-07
1
-2
/
+2
|
\
|
*
QSPP::startAsyncRead(): set a correct type for variable
Alex Trotsenko
2017-05-04
1
-1
/
+1
|
*
Fix possible UB in ReadFile()
v5.9.0-beta4
Alex Trotsenko
2017-04-25
1
-1
/
+1
*
|
Use local copy of QWinOverlappedIoNotifier
Denis Shienkov
2017-05-17
1
-1
/
+1
*
|
Improve read performance when the buffer size is limited
Alex Trotsenko
2017-04-26
1
-2
/
+1
*
|
Increase buffer chunk sizes
Denis Shienkov
2017-04-26
1
-3
/
+5
*
|
Simplify QSPP::standardBaudRates() method
Denis Shienkov
2017-04-09
1
-72
/
+8
*
|
Create notifier only in end of successful initialization
Denis Shienkov
2017-04-09
1
-3
/
+3
*
|
Get rid of originalEventMask member
Denis Shienkov
2017-04-09
1
-8
/
+6
|
/
*
Do not reset RTS after changing other properties on Windows
Denis Shienkov
2016-09-23
1
-2
/
+11
*
Merge remote-tracking branch 'origin/5.6' into 5.7
Liang Qi
2016-08-01
1
-13
/
+9
|
\
|
*
Detach buffer's segment for asynchronous write operation
Denis Shienkov
2016-07-20
1
-13
/
+9
*
|
Start the write timer only when it is inactive
Denis Shienkov
2016-07-13
1
-1
/
+2
*
|
Use append() instead of memcpy() where possible
Denis Shienkov
2016-07-07
1
-5
/
+3
*
|
Minimize number of system calls at opening
Denis Shienkov
2016-07-07
1
-68
/
+104
*
|
Replace 'Q_NULLPTR' and 'NULL' with 'nullptr'
Denis Shienkov
2016-06-17
1
-9
/
+9
*
|
Add some missed 'const' and 'Q_NULLPTR' keywords
Denis Shienkov
2016-06-03
1
-3
/
+3
*
|
Merge 5.7 into 5.7.0
Oswald Buddenhagen
2016-05-20
1
-10
/
+19
|
\
\
|
*
\
Merge remote-tracking branch 'origin/5.6' into 5.7
Liang Qi
2016-05-19
1
-10
/
+19
|
|
\
\
|
|
|
/
|
|
*
Remove superfluous check during removal of the pointer
Denis Shienkov
2016-05-04
1
-8
/
+4
|
|
*
Fix reading of data remainder with CDC USB device on Windows
Denis Shienkov
2016-04-27
1
-2
/
+15
*
|
|
Replace 'forever' with 'for(;;)'
Denis Shienkov
2016-05-20
1
-1
/
+1
|
/
/
*
|
Unify license header usage
Antti Kokko
2016-02-02
1
-13
/
+19
|
/
*
Get rid of QSPP::updateCommTimeouts() method
Denis Shienkov
2016-01-11
1
-10
/
+3
*
Suppress error emission when closing
Denis Shienkov
2016-01-11
1
-9
/
+4
*
Do not use settingFromBaudRate() on Windows
v5.6.0-beta1
Denis Shienkov
2015-12-13
1
-9
/
+0
*
Use qt_subtract_from_timeout() to reduce a code duplication
Denis Shienkov
2015-10-10
1
-3
/
+5
*
Remove unused QSPP::baudRateFromSetting() method
Denis Shienkov
2015-10-06
1
-9
/
+0
*
Cleanup remainders of code relating to data error policy handling
Denis Shienkov
2015-09-24
1
-63
/
+5
*
Get rid of stored DCB structure
Denis Shienkov
2015-09-07
1
-49
/
+83
*
Clear the communicationStarted flag on close
Denis Shienkov
2015-09-06
1
-0
/
+1
*
Use the new signal/slot syntax everywhere
v5.6.0-alpha1
Denis Shienkov
2015-09-02
1
-3
/
+3
*
Unify common error strings in QSerialPortErrorInfo
Denis Shienkov
2015-08-28
1
-3
/
+3
*
Avoid to start of communication notifier if it already is active
Denis Shienkov
2015-08-27
1
-0
/
+6
*
Handle ERROR_PATH_NOT_FOUND error code on Windows
Denis Shienkov
2015-08-26
1
-0
/
+3
*
Delete the startAsyncWriteTimer object on close
Denis Shienkov
2015-08-06
1
-0
/
+5
*
Delete the notifiers immediatelly on close
Denis Shienkov
2015-08-06
1
-2
/
+4
*
Give custom descriptions to errors which had none before
Denis Shienkov
2015-07-09
1
-8
/
+6
*
Improve the processing of errors
Denis Shienkov
2015-07-08
1
-91
/
+63
*
Fix opening of Exar VCP on Windows
Denis Shienkov
2015-07-08
1
-0
/
+2
*
Fix reading when switching from asynchronous to synchronous approach
Denis Shienkov
2015-07-07
1
-6
/
+8
*
Get rid of QSPP::bytesToWrite()
Denis Shienkov
2015-07-01
1
-5
/
+0
*
Get rid of QSPP::readData()
Denis Shienkov
2015-06-30
1
-16
/
+0
*
Do not use the queued connection to handle an I/O events on Windows
Denis Shienkov
2015-06-23
1
-51
/
+4
*
Remove unused readyReadEmitted variable
Denis Shienkov
2015-04-19
1
-2
/
+0
*
Fix reading on Windows with the limited read buffer
Denis Shienkov
2015-03-02
1
-6
/
+7
*
Merge remote-tracking branch 'origin/5.4' into 5.5
Frederik Gladhorn
2015-02-25
1
-13
/
+11
|
\
|
*
Merge remote-tracking branch 'origin/5.3' into 5.4
Frederik Gladhorn
2014-12-17
1
-8
/
+6
|
|
\
|
|
*
Improve the QSP::clear() on Windows
Denis Shienkov
2014-11-27
1
-5
/
+2
[next]